A Kennebecasis Regional Police officer has been placed under suspension while an unknown investigation is underway, the police service confirms.
Deputy Chief Steve Palmer told Global News the suspension was issued following an internal complaint.
The officer has been taken off active duty but no other details are being released, including the identity of the suspended officer.
An investigation is underway and the suspension will remain in place until the probe is complete.
Kennebecasis is located just outside Saint John.
